HIVE Digital is increasingly focusing on GPU hours instead of relying only on Bitcoin mining hashprice. The company is expanding its high-performance computing infrastructure to support artificial intelligence workloads. This move allows HIVE Digital to generate revenue from GPU hours used for AI training and data processing. The shift comes as Bitcoin mining profitability faces pressure from network difficulty and the 2024 halving. Lower block rewards reduce mining revenue across the industry. HIVE Digital is therefore allocating more computing resources to GPU-based services. These resources can be leased to companies that require large amounts of computing power. The company continues to operate large mining farms but is gradually integrating AI computing into its operations.


HIVE Digital GPU Hours Replace Dependence on Hashprice

Hashprice measures the daily revenue miners earn from each unit of mining power. The metric declined after the Bitcoin halving reduced the block reward. Increased network competition has also pushed mining difficulty higher. These conditions lower the income generated by mining hardware.

HIVE Digital has begun addressing this challenge by prioritizing GPU hours for artificial intelligence workloads. GPUs can process complex parallel tasks required for machine learning models. Companies developing AI systems often rent GPU capacity from data centers. HIVE Digital’s infrastructure allows it to supply these resources. Instead of relying entirely on mining rewards, the company can earn revenue from compute time sold to AI customers.


Data Centers Expanding to Support HIVE Digital GPU Hours

HIVE Digital operates data centers in Canada, Sweden, and other locations. Several of these facilities are being upgraded to support high-performance computing clusters. The company is installing large GPU arrays designed for AI training and cloud computing tasks.

One major project is a Tier III+ data center planned in New Brunswick, Canada. The facility is expected to host tens of thousands of advanced GPUs. This infrastructure will significantly increase the company’s capacity to deliver GPU hours to enterprise clients. Existing mining infrastructure already provides power systems and cooling environments suitable for high-density computing.


AI Demand Drives Growth in HIVE Digital GPU Hours

Demand for AI computing power has grown rapidly across multiple industries. Technology companies require large GPU clusters to train machine learning models. These workloads often run continuously for extended periods. This creates a strong market for rented computing capacity.

HIVE Digital’s high-performance computing division provides GPU resources to organizations developing AI applications. The company leases computing power through service agreements that measure usage in GPU hours. This revenue stream can operate independently of cryptocurrency market cycles.

Bitcoin mining remains part of HIVE Digital’s operations. However, the company’s strategy now combines mining infrastructure with AI computing services. The expansion of GPU capacity allows HIVE Digital to diversify income sources while maintaining its presence in the digital asset industry.
